Dike-Newell School is a public school administered by the RSU 01 - LKRSU district in Bath, MAINE, providing education at the Elementary level for students in grades PK–02.

Key statistics: 225 students enrolled; a 11.5:1 student-to-teacher ratio.

The school is classified as Town: Fringe by the NCES locale classification system.
